Transaction e34dbdc5363c9354a7fe73f75eccf7bef6902c4d23b9b67b832958d764c4be6b
1 Input
1 Output
-
e34dbdc5363c9354a7fe73f75eccf7bef6902c4d23b9b67b832958d764c4be6b:0
- value
- 362512
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c153cf069f90f67d1d546e95152638aa5bb5467f OP_EQUAL
- address
- 3KKEjhPiyA5uLiisxQP5SG4yULH82EhWkv